CoxHealth is a leading healthcare system serving 25 counties across southwest Missouri and northern Arkansas. The organization includes six hospitals, 5 ERs, and over 80 clinics. CoxHealth has earned the following honors for workplace excellence:

Job Summary
Speech-language pathologists assess, diagnose, treat, and help to prevent speech, language, social communication, cognitive-communication and swallowing disorders in children and adults. They will develop or implement treatment plans for problems that include, but are not limited to, stuttering, delayed language, swallowing disorders, inappropriate pitch or harsh voice problems, and social communication disorders.
